What is technical SEO?

Technical SEO is everything that ensures search engines can read and display your website without problems. Not the content of your pages, but the foundation beneath it: speed, structure, indexability and code.

You can have the best content in your sector. If Google cannot crawl or understand your pages well, they stay invisible. In practice we see that a large part of lost rankings is not down to the text, but to technical blockages that nobody ever noticed. The pillars of technical SEO

Technical SEO breaks down into a handful of pillars. Below, for each pillar, is what it is, how you check it yourself, and the mistake we come across most often.

Crawlability and indexation

This is the most fundamental layer: can Google find (crawl) your important pages and include them in the search index (index)? What is not in the index simply cannot rank. Search engines start from your robots.txt and follow your links from there.

How to check: type site:yourdomain.com into Google and see whether your important pages come back. In addition, use the indexing report in Google Search Console to see which pages are excluded and why. You will find more depth in our guide on getting a page indexed.

Common mistake: an accidentally leftover noindex tag or a block in robots.txt that was never reverted after a migration.

A logical structure shows Google which pages are important and how they relate. Internal links are the binding agent here: they distribute authority and provide context. A flat, well thought out structure where your key pages are reachable within a few clicks almost always works better than a deep, branching tree.

How to check: click through yourself from your homepage to your most important page. If you need more than three or four clicks, that page sits too deep. Check that every important page gets at least one internal link.

Common mistake: valuable content without a single internal link, also known as an orphan page, which Google therefore barely picks up.

Speed and Core Web Vitals

A fast site is better for your visitors and for your rankings. Google measures the user experience with the Core Web Vitals, which we explain separately below. Speed starts with good hosting and a light page: large images, heavy scripts and slow servers are the usual culprits.

How to check: run your most important pages through a free speed tool or through PageSpeed Insights and check whether you stay under three seconds of load time. For concrete fixes, we have a guide on improving your Core Web Vitals.

Common mistake: testing only on desktop, while the majority of your visitors arrive via mobile on a slower connection.

Mobile friendliness

Google indexes your site based on the mobile version. If something does not work or read smoothly on a smartphone, that counts as the standard experience. Buttons that are too small, text you have to zoom in on and elements that overlap: these are all signals that the mobile experience is off.

How to check: open your site on your own phone and try to carry out the most important action, for example filling in a form. More guidelines are in our guide on building a mobile friendly website.

Common mistake: a beautiful desktop design that loads slowly on mobile or where the call-to-action disappears below the fold.

HTTPS and security

A valid SSL certificate has been a basic requirement for years. It encrypts the traffic between visitor and server, and Google uses HTTPS as a light ranking signal. On top of that, browsers mark sites without a certificate as “not secure”, which costs trust and therefore conversion.

How to check: look for a padlock in the address bar and whether all pages redirect automatically to the https:// version. You can read the background in our explanation of SSL and HTTPS.

Common mistake: a certificate that is installed, but where individual pages or images still load over http (mixed content).

Structured data (schema)

With schema markup you give search engines and AI models extra context about your content: what is a product, a review, an FAQ or a company. Applied correctly, you stand a chance of richer displays in the search results and are more often correctly understood by AI answers.

How to check: test your pages with Google’s Rich Results Test and see whether your schema is recognised without errors.

Common mistake: adding schema for content that is not visible on the page, which goes against the guidelines and can result in a manual action.

Canonicals and duplicate content

If the same or very similar content is reachable via multiple URLs, Google does not know which version to show. Those pages then compete with each other. With a canonical tag you point to the preferred version, so that the ranking signals come together on one URL.

How to check: hunt for the same page at multiple addresses (with and without www, with and without trailing slash, with filter parameters) and check that every variant points to the same canonical. You will find depth at duplicate content.

Common mistake: a canonical that points to the wrong or to a non-indexable page, which knocks you out of the index yourself.

Core Web Vitals explained

Core Web Vitals are the figures with which Google measures the user experience. Three weigh the heaviest, each with a clear target value:

  • LCP (loading speed): how fast the largest element on your page appears. Aim for less than 2.5 seconds.
  • INP (responsiveness): how fast your page responds to a click or tap. Aim for less than 200 milliseconds.
  • CLS (visual stability): whether the page does not jump around while loading. Keep this under 0.1. An overview of the Core Web Vitals lays out those threshold values neatly.

A slow or unstable page drives visitors away. You see that reflected in a higher bounce rate, and Google sees it too. According to research by Pingdom, the bounce rate rises from 6% at a load time of 2 seconds to 38% at 5 seconds. Every extra second therefore literally costs you visitors, and with them leads.

Technical SEO checklist

Run through this list for your most important pages:

  1. Type site:yourdomain.com into Google. Are your important pages in there?
  2. Test your load speed with a free speed tool. Under 3 seconds?
  3. Do you hit your Core Web Vitals: LCP under 2.5 seconds, INP under 200 milliseconds, CLS under 0.1?
  4. Does everything work smoothly on mobile?
  5. Does every page have a unique title and description?
  6. Do your pages link to each other with internal links?
  7. Are there broken links or error pages?

Frequently asked questions

Is technical SEO a one-off or ongoing job?

Both. The big base (indexation, speed, HTTPS, structure) you get in order in a single project. After that it is maintenance: with every new page, redesign or migration, technical mistakes can creep back in. That is why we keep an eye on the most important signals in Search Console continuously.

Can I do technical SEO myself?

You can largely carry out the checks in this article yourself with free tools like Google Search Console and PageSpeed Insights. For more complex interventions (canonicalisation, crawl budget, schema, migrations) technical knowledge is needed. Google lays out the official guidelines in Google Search Central.

How fast do I see results from technical SEO?

Fixing indexation problems can become visible within days to weeks, as soon as Google recrawls your pages. Speed and structure work through more gradually. Remember that technique rarely leads to more leads on its own: it takes the brake off, after which strong content and authority make the difference.
